Collision avoidance is extremely important for UAV flight.When the UAV does not have accurate position information,and especially the UAV global positioning system (GPS) signal failures,collision avoidance must be proposed to control the UAV's flight.This paper presents analysis of collision detection,based on collision probability calculated from distance measurement,given the received radio frequency signal strength,and proposes orthogonal rules to modify the UAVs' predefined flight routes for collision avoidance.Theoretical analysis and experimental results demonstrate the validity of the collision avoidance strategy to provide safe flight routes for UAVs.%碰撞避免算法对无人机群的安全飞行极其重要.当无人机无法获得准确的定位信息,特别是其全球定位系统(GPS)信号失效时,更需要准确高效的碰撞躲避和控制算法.利用无人机的无线射频信号,根据信号强度估算无人机间的距离和飞行信息,计算碰撞概率,采用正交规则修改预设的飞行路线,提出完整的无人机碰撞避免系统方法.理论分析和实验测试结果证实了此避碰策略的有效性,从而使无人机获得安全的飞行路线.
